ABSOLUTE MAXIMUM RATING (Beyond which damage may occur)1
Supply Voltages
AVDD (measured to AVSS) ........................... -0.3 to 7.0 V
Output Current
IOUT ............................................................................. 0 to 7 mA
Input Voltage
Temperature
Clock and Data ......................................... AVSS to AVDD
Operating, ambient ........................................ 0 to +70 °C
Storage ..................................................... -55 to +125 °C
Note: 1. Operation at any Absolute Maximum Ratings is not implied. See Electrical Specifications for proper nominal applied
conditions in typical applications.
